Get wild. Get messy. 'Dad dance' like no one's watching. Nourish your body and mind. Let go of the reins and the routines. Make memories and have some serious fun. From the co-founders of the award-winning family festival, Camp Bestival at Home is the perfect handbook for parents who want to bring the magical ethos of the festival home. Packed with activities, recipes and ideas to keep the whole family inspired all year round, why not get back to nature and stargaze. For kids with endless energy, you could organise a kitchen disco or put on a show. Go foraging, learn circus skills and face painting, or make festive decorations. And relax after all the activity with a family feast, plus some yoga for the grown-ups. Written and illustrated by Camp Bestival co-founders Josie and Rob da Bank, with contributions from celebrity friends and festival regulars Fatboy Slim, Sara Cox, Sophie Ellis-Bextor, Fearne Cotton and Jo Whiley.
Autorenporträt
Josie da Bank is an artist, illustrator and co-founder of the UK's most acclaimed family festival, Camp Bestival. She is best known for her unique artistic style - think post-acid house meets hippy. She has designed sleeves for her husband Rob's Sunday Best Recordings compilations, curated one of Shoreditch's first stylish bars, Cocomo, and produced two of the best-loved festivals of this century - Bestival and Camp Bestival. Oh, and not forgetting the small matter of raising four sons. Her recent projects include designing bars and restaurants on the Isle of Wight, one of the few benefits of taking an enforced break from the event industry during the pandemic. Josie and Rob have also established Slow Motion Wellness - a site with luxury accommodation for cold water therapy retreats, meditation workshops, yoga (which Josie sometimes teaches) and more.
